i also trialed the abs sensor crank trigger on the 202 for the first time in a real life situation, and these are the results, bit disapointing, not sure if the bracket is flexing or some other issue but needless to say it was retired for the rest of the weekend.
so just for reference sake here is a log of the last run of the day using the dizzy pickup, as you can see its rougher in the low rpms but not much difference higher in the rev range! also shows my methanol fuelling is allmost spot on
so to round up the weekend, i managed a best of 8.108 (previous PB at WSID was 8.16) and was knocked out in the semi final by a better reaction time.
Scotty's nos solenoid shit itself so he ran naturally aspirated all weekend and after some tweaking of the tune for no nos he went from 9.7's to a best of 9.355 and got second in the final for his class, and also dialed in a 9.40 and nailed a 9.40 solo run in eliminations, so he walked away with two trophys for his efforts!
